Hyderabad: Telangana Anti-Corruption Bureau officials on Monday caught Gorla Panini, District Educational Officer of Mulugu, and Thotte Dilip Kumar Yadav, a junior assistant in the establishment section of the DEO office, while accepting a bribe of ₹20,000.
The bribe was allegedly demanded to process the joining report of the complainant and issue the necessary orders allowing the assumption of duties. The ACB said both officials were caught red-handed following a complaint.
